Ver Mensaje Individual
  #4 (permalink)  
Antiguo 11/06/2009, 04:39
pesoft
 
Fecha de Ingreso: abril-2005
Mensajes: 22
Antigüedad: 19 años, 1 mes
Puntos: 0
Respuesta: Variables de sesion

Siento meterme sin poder dar ayuda... pero es que me pasa algo muy muy similar y me estoy volviendo loco.

En la página destino, he incluido incluso un control que he visto en otra página para saber sí acepto o no cookies...

<?php
session_start();

if(isset($_COOKIE["PHPSESSID"]))
{
session_start();
echo $_SESSION['data'];
echo "prueba";
}
else
{
echo "no cookies required!";
}
?>

Y en el caso de navegador que acepta cookies, escribe el 'prueba', pero salvo una vez al principio, nunca me devuelve el valor del data que he grabado en la página del login.

He leído que sí el session.start(), ha de ser la primera línea del código, que sí el register global que he visto lo tengo a Si en el php.ini.

En el colmo de las ñapas, se me está ocurriendo (sino doy con esto), el incluir en todas las páginas que necesito ese valor un formulario con un sólo campo oculto del data, para irlo pasando de una a otra y tenerlo disponible.
Lo único que quiero hacer es saber sí se ha logado, para dejarle ver las páginas por las que va, o sino llevarle a la del login.

Saludos,